Abstract

According to one embodiment, an illumination device includes a first light guide including a first main surface, a second main surface, a first side surface and a second side surface, a first light source and a first layer including a first prism provided on the second side surface. The first prism protrudes from the second main surface toward the opposite side to the first main surface and has a cross-sectional shape of a triangle with a first slope and a second slope. The incident angle of light emitted from the first light source and entering the first light guide from the second side surface, the angle between the first slope and the first direction, and the angle between the first slope and the second slope are set to values that satisfy the predetermined conditions, respectively.
